To widen their perspectives on the world, numerous sisters from the province participated in GAAP (Global Apostolic Awareness Program). After the lectures, discussions, and experience in a third-world nation, the sisters returned to their current ministry and found ways to integrate what they had learned into projects that would build toward global social justice.
This program, directed by Sister Irene Hughes, provided SSNDs with a six-week missionary experience in Honduras and Guatemala The former has the highest level of poverty in Latin America. In Guatemala, more than half of its citizens live below the poverty line. In addition to working in these countries, the 15 participants reflect on and discuss the topics of mission, social justice, global interdependence, and evangelization.
